I was wondering if I use a Canadian e gift card (visa / Mastercard, not a Spotify gift card), then will my account have its location updated to Canada?

 

I wanted to change location from Australia to Canada for travel but I don’t have a Canadian card so I was wondering if this was a work around. I’ve also considered using Wise but the card’s BIN probably tells Spotify that it was issued in Australia even though it’s loaded in CAD.

When it comes to using a prepaid Visa card, I can’t guarantee it’ll work for updating your payment method directly—those can be a bit hit or miss depending on how they were issued.

 

What you can do instead is cancel your current subscription and wait for your account to revert to Free. Once that happens, you’ll be able to update your country setting to Canada using the dropdown menu as shown here.

 

After that, you should be able to redeem a Spotify Gift Card—just make sure the card is valid for use in Canada.

 

If that prepaid Visa works for purchasing a Canadian Spotify Gift Card, that route might be your best bet. Let me know how things go! 🙂

If you’re only visiting Canada and already have an active Premium subscription, there’s no need to update your payment method or country setting—your account will continue working just fine while you’re abroad.

 

That said, if you’re now based in Canada and have a Canadian payment method, you can update your payment details through your account page.

 

Just make sure to scroll down and select Canada at the bottom of the page before choosing your payment method. Your account’s country setting will then update automatically on your next billing date.
